Red Hat OpenShift Container Platform is the company's cloud computing
Platform-as-a-Service (PaaS) solution designed for on-premise or private
cloud deployments.
This advisory contains the RPM packages for Red Hat OpenShift Container
Platform 3.9.31. See the following advisory for the container images for
this release:
https://access.redhat.com/errata/RHBA-2018:2014
Security Fix(es):
* routing: Malicious Service configuration can bring down routing for an
entire shard (CVE-2018-1070)
* openshift-ansible: Incorrectly quoted values in etcd.conf causes
disabling of SSL client certificate authentication (CVE-2018-1085)
* source-to-image: Builder images with assembler-user LABEL set to root
allows attackers to execute arbitrary code (CVE-2018-10843)
For more details about the security issue(s), including the impact, a CVSS
score, acknowledgments, and other related information, refer to the CVE
page(s) listed in the References section.
Red Hat would like to thank David Hocky (Comcast) for reporting
CVE-2018-1085. The CVE-2018-1070 issue was discovered by Mark Chappell (Red
Hat) and the CVE-2018-10843 issue was discovered by Jeremy Choi (Red Hat).
